WWDC kicks off tomorrow, and the last minute rumours are coming in fast and furious. Earlier we heard about iCloud replacing iTunes, and the possibility of Time Capsules playing a larger role than expected.
The latest picture on the web as posted by TechCrunch reveals an apparent iOS 5 homescreen showing the possible product of the rumoured twitter integration within the next version of iOS. As you’ll notice the weather icon shows celsius (update: this is a regional setting, thanks for the reminder @jordan_yee), the camera app icon looks different, and there’s a slight twitter notification bar up top, that resembles a slimmed down version of MobileNotifier.
Is this what iOS 5 could look like? If it’s real, it’s definitely underwhelming. I’m going to file this under the ‘last minute rumours’ pile. What do you think? Real or fake?
